Engineered For Any Environment

High-Temperature & High-Pressure Environments

The high performance valve features an inherent fire-safe design (API 609) and an anti-blowout stem, ensuring operational safety under extreme conditions.

Corrosive Environments

JRVAL, as a double eccentric butterfly valve supplier, can provide materials compliant with NACE MR0175 / ISO 15156 standards, suitable for sour service environments containing H₂S.

Abrasive Environments with Particles

JRVAL's double offset high performance butterfly valve with a tungsten carbide coated disc can extend service life by 5-10 times compared to standard stainless steel discs under similar wear conditions. Stellite hardfaced discs can extend life by 3-5 times.

Vibration Environments

JRVAL’s optimized stem connection and support design for the high performance butterfly valve allows it to withstand continuous industrial vibrations, with some designs capable of handling vibration accelerations up to 2G.

Space-Constrained Environments

The most significant advantage of the high performance wafer butterfly valve is its extremely short face-to-face dimension. For example, a JRVAL PN16 DN200 butterfly valve has a face-to-face length of approximately 60mm

Cryogenic Environments

JRVAL's cryogenic butterfly valve, featuring an eccentric butterfly valve design, achieves bubble-tight zero leakage (e.g., API 598 or ISO 5208 Rate A) at its design temperature. For helium leak tests, it can achieve ≤1x10⁻⁶ Pa·m³/s (per customer requirements).

Specific Application Solutions

Water Supply Systems

JRVAL's double offset butterfly valve, with its EPDM seat and double eccentric structure, can achieve over 50,000 switching cycles in clean water media, with some optimized designs reaching over 100,000 cycles.

Wastewater Treatment Systems

The JRVAL's butterfly valve eccentric type, due to its optimized disc movement path from the double eccentric structure, can reduce the probability of jamming and clogging by approximately 40-60% compared to concentric butterfly valves.

Semiconductor Ultrapure Water Systems

Mirror-polished (Ra≤0.2μm) high performance double offset butterfly valve meets SEMI F57 standards with zero deadleg design.

Fire Protection Systems

JRVAL, as one of the high performance butterfly valves manufacturers, can provide valves certified to API 609 or ISO 10497 fire tests, ensuring post-fire leakage meets standard requirements.

HVAC Systems

The precise flow regulation and near equal percentage flow characteristic of the JRVAL valve contribute to its excellent butterfly performance. Its adjustability ratio typically reaches 50:1 to 100:1, superior to concentric butterfly valves (usually 30:1), enabling finer temperature and flow control.

Fuel Gas Systems

The JRVAL's worm gear type butterfly valve offers low fugitive emissions, capable of meeting ISO 15848-1 BH C03 level (leakage rate ≤50 ppmv CH₄ at 200°C, 20,000 cycles) or API 624 requirements.

Worm Gear Butterfly Valve FAQ

What operational advantages does the "pinless connection" provide for gear operator applications?

Our pinless construction ensures rigid, zero-backlash torque transmission from the gear operator to the disc. This is critical for large or high-pressure valves, eliminating stress points and preventing failures caused by pin shearing or loosening under high torque loads.

What seat materials are available, and what is their expected service life in mildly abrasive media?

We offer a range of high-performance seats selected based on ASTM standards:

Glass-filled PTFE (RPTFE): Excellent chemical resistance.

PEEK (Carbon-Reinforced): For temperatures up to 260°C.

UHMWPE: Superior wear resistance for slurry services up to 80°C.

Expected life ranges from 50,000 to 100,000 cycles in moderate abrasion. Contact us for a precise wear rate calculation for your specific application.

What is the operating torque? Can a DN300 valve be manually operated by a single person?

Yes. Our high-efficiency gearboxes (≥92%) are optimized for easy operation. For a typical DN300 Class 150 valve, the breakaway torque is ≤350 N·m. Paired with a standard 800mm handwheel, this is well within the capability for single-person manual operation. Detailed torque charts are available.
